The matter of potholes on Delhi-Dehradun Expressway reached Parliament, government said – ‘The contractor has paid at his own expense.


Delhi Dehradun Expressway: Just a few months after the inauguration of the Delhi-Dehradun Expressway, the matter of finding potholes on it has now reached Parliament. The central government admitted in the Rajya Sabha that two potholes were found on the expressway. However, the government said that the road is still under the 10-year defect liability period, so the construction company repaired it as part of its responsibility without any government expense. At the same time, the government did not tell why the potholes were formed on the new road.

What did the government say in Rajya Sabha?

Answering the question of MP Ashok Singh in the Rajya Sabha, Union Road Transport and Highways Minister Nitin Gadkari said that the Delhi-Dehradun Access Controlled Highway is currently in the defect liability period of 10 years. He said that during this period two potholes were found on the expressway. The contractor, fulfilling his responsibility as per the contract, repaired both the potholes at his own expense. For this the government did not have to bear any additional expense.

Government did not answer on the reason for potholes

The government in its reply did not clarify the reason for the formation of potholes on the newly constructed road. The only reply given was that the road was under guarantee period and when any defect was found, the construction company rectified it.

What is defect liability period?

Defect liability period is the fixed period in which the contractor is responsible to correct any technical defect or construction defect related to road construction. During this period, the entire cost of repair is borne by the construction company and not the government. This period has been fixed at 10 years for Delhi-Dehradun Expressway.

How did the controversy start?

Prime Minister to inaugurate Delhi-Dehradun Expressway on 14 April 2026 Narendra Modi was did. This 210 kilometer long expressway has been constructed at a cost of approximately Rs 12 thousand crores. A few months after the inauguration, videos of potholes on the expressway near Shamli during monsoon went viral on social media. After this, questions started being raised regarding the quality of the road and safety of passengers. The opposition also cornered the government on this issue.

Earlier, in the field level response of the National Highways Authority of India (NHAI), waterlogging and incomplete drainage system were cited as possible reasons. However, in the reply given in the Rajya Sabha, the government did not mention the reason for the potholes.

Action taken against 103 agencies in three years

In response to the same question, the government also said that action has been taken against 103 agencies, contractors and companies during the last three years in cases of poor quality or violation of contract terms in National Highway projects. Blacklisting, imposing fines and other punitive measures were taken against them. According to the government, action was taken against 29 agencies in the year 2023-24, 29 agencies in 2024-25 and 45 agencies in 2025-26.
